Doctor Who/Big Finish actor dies

Actor David Bailie, known for his performances on stage television and film has passed away at the age of 83.


His death was announced on the Big Finish twitter page.


Bailie played Dask (Taren Capel) in the Doctor Who television story The Robots of Death. In the serial, the Fourth Doctor (Tom Baker) and Leela (Louise Jameson) arrive on a sandminer whose crew, from a robot-dependent civilisation, are being murdered.

He reprised the role of Taren Capel in the Kaldor City audio plays Taren Capel and Checkmate.

In 2009 he played the Celestial Toymaker in the Big Finish Productions audio dramas The Nightmare Fair and Solitaire.


Bailie also appeared in Blake’s 7, on film, he played the mute pirate Cotton in the Pirates of the Caribbean series.

Bailie was also a professional photographer, specialising in portrait photography.
